RocketMQ 是一款開源的消息中間件,采用Java實(shí)現(xiàn),設(shè)計思想來自于Kafka(Scala實(shí)現(xiàn)),在具體設(shè)計時體現(xiàn)了自己的選擇和需求,具體差別可以看RocketMQ與Ka
前面我也跟大家講述了 RocketMQ 讀寫分離的規(guī)則,但是你可能會問,主從服務(wù)器之間的消費(fèi)進(jìn)度是如何保持同步的?下面我來給大家解答一下。如果消費(fèi)者消費(fèi)模式不同,也會有不同的保存方式,消費(fèi)者端的消息消
RocketMQ介紹概述Apache RocketMQ是一個具有低延遲、高性能和高可靠性、萬億級容量,同時具備靈活的、可伸縮性強(qiáng)的分布式消息流處理平臺,它由四個部分組成:name servers, b
如果從gitub上下載源碼需要maven編譯比較麻煩,這里有現(xiàn)成的可以直接運(yùn)行的:rocketMQ_4.1.0 編譯好可以直接運(yùn)行的版本:鏈接:https://pan.baidu.com/s/11MT
參考http://www.linuxidc.com/Linux/2015-10/124112.htm 192.168.1.201vi /usr/local/tomcat/webapps/appServ
一. 前言 RocketMQ支持消息消費(fèi)失敗后重新消費(fèi),具體代碼如下: /* * Register callback to execute on arrival of messag
準(zhǔn)備材料:Linux操作環(huán)境( 假設(shè)兩臺服務(wù)器ip為:192.168.74.130和192.168.74.131);RocketMQJDK 1.8+分別修改兩臺服務(wù)RockerMQ的配置文件,路徑為:
背景 公司很多業(yè)務(wù)在使用RocketMQ,前期業(yè)務(wù)量小,沒啥問題,也沒有太關(guān)注集群的可用性這塊,所以全公司的業(yè)務(wù)公用一個集群,隨之公司的業(yè)務(wù)量增加,業(yè)務(wù)對RocketMQ集群依賴越來越重,開始思考集群
微信公眾號「后端進(jìn)階」,專注后端技術(shù)分享:Java、Golang、WEB框架、分布式中間件、服務(wù)治理等等。 前段時間有個朋友向我提了一個問題,他說在搭建 RocketMQ 集群過程中遇到了關(guān)于消費(fèi)